> Currently the Dsitribution Event package contains the following details:
>  * Distribution Component Name
>  * Distribution Component Kind
>  * Distribution Type
>  * Distribution Paths
>  
> Improvement aims at adding the queue item creation time, essentially when the 
> the item was creation for the first time, and enqueue into the queue. The 
> value does not change over retries (on failure).
>  
> The purpose to get this detail is to be able to capture metrics at the 
> consumer level. The consumers could have an event handler, which can capture 
> the duration which turns out to be (NOW MINUS queue item creation time thrown 
> in the distribution event package); NOW being the current time in the event 
> handler (consumer).
